Abstract
Disclosed are compositions that include a structuring agent, a silicone powder and a swelling agent, other compositions further including a liquid fatty phase, methods of making the compositions, and their use on keratin material.

A cosmetic composition, comprising: a structuring agent comprising a polymer skeleton having a hydrocarbon-based repeating unit comprising at least one hetero atom; a liquid fatty phase; a silicone elastomer powder comprising a silicone elastomer core coated with a silicone resin; and a swelling agent for said powder.
2 . The cosmetic composition of claim 1 , wherein said structuring agent further comprises at least one fatty chain bonded to said polymer skeleton.
3 . The cosmetic composition of claim 2 , wherein said fatty chain is a pendant chain.
4 . The cosmetic composition of claim 2 , wherein said fatty chain is a terminal chain.
5 . The cosmetic composition of claim 4 , wherein said fatty chain is bonded to said polymer skeleton via an ester group.
6 . The cosmetic composition of claim 2 , wherein said structuring agent comprises a plurality of fatty chains, including a terminal fatty chain.
7 . The cosmetic composition of claim 2 , wherein said fatty chain is functionalized.
8 . The cosmetic composition of claim 1 , wherein said polymer skeleton is a polyamide.
9 . The cosmetic composition of claim 8 , wherein said structuring agent is chosen from polyamide polymers of formula (I):
wherein:
n is an integer which represents the number of amide units such that the number of ester groups present in said at least one polyamide polymer ranges from 10% to 50% of the total number of all ester groups and all amide groups comprised in said at least one polyamide polymer;
R 1 , which are identical or different, are each chosen from alkyl groups comprising at least 4 carbon atoms and alkenyl groups comprising at least 4 carbon atoms;
R 2 , which are identical or different, are each chosen from C 4 to C 42 hydrocarbon-based groups with the proviso that at least 50% of all R 2 are chosen from C 30 to C 42 hydrocarbon-based groups;
R 3 , which are identical or different, are each chosen from organic groups comprising atoms chosen from carbon atoms, hydrogen atoms, oxygen atoms and nitrogen atoms, with the proviso that R 3 comprises at least 2 carbon atoms; and
R 4 , which are identical or different, are each chosen from hydrogen atoms, C 1 to C 10 alkyl groups and a direct bond to at least one group chosen from R 3 and another R 4 such that when said at least one group is chosen from another R 4 , the nitrogen atom to which both R 3 and R 4 are bonded forms part of a heterocyclic structure defined in part by R 4 —N—R 3 , with the proviso that at least 50% of all R 4 are chosen from hydrogen atoms.
